Thu Dec  5 11:42:38 UTC 2019 - John Paul Adrian Glaubitz <adrian.glaubitz@suse.com>

- Update to version 1.16
  + Support Python 3 for tests
- from version 1.15
  + Properly support Python3
- from version 1.14
  + Tolerate EFS state directory existing during mount
- from version 1.13
  + Change watchdog configuration so it stops after all file systems are unmounted
- from version 1.12
  + Update stunnel idle timeout
    * The default stunnel idle timeout is many hours. By setting it to a value based
      on the NFS lease length we can recover from network partitions sooner.
- from version 1.11
  + Add support for RHEL8
    * Fixes Python shebangs to work on systems without a default "python" version.
    * Fixes watchdog process not being properly started on systemd systems.
- from version 1.10
  + Update to default configuration that disables OCSP
    * To use OCSP, the client accessing EFS must be able to reach the Amazon Certificate
      Authority (CA). To maximize file system availability in the event that the CA is
      not reachable from your VPC, the EFS mount helper no longer enables OCSP by default.
